Job title: SHE Associate
Location: Barrow-in-Furness. Onsite
Salary: Circa £37,000
What you’ll be doing:
* Gain foundational knowledge of Safety, Health and Environmental (SHE) practices within an engineering / manufacturing environment under appropriate supervision
* Complete all required SHE foundation training with guidance from supervision
* Develop role-specific competencies through structured on-the-job learning and practical experience
* Assist SHE function team members in the implementation of safety, health and environmental programs
* Undertake selected tasks typically performed by higher graded SHE roles as part of professional development and preparation for increased responsibilities
* Monitor and evaluate the effectiveness of assigned activities, providing regular updates and reports to relevant stakeholders, including supervisory personnel
* Contribute to the development and promotion of a strong safety culture within the Submarines business, actively supporting the SHE improvement programme
Your skills and experiences:
Essential:
* Experience of working in potentially high-risk environments / and or demonstrate transferrable skills and experience
* Assist and positively influence stakeholders in their planning, management, monitoring, investigation and assurance activities
* Ensure compliance and continuous improvement in SHE and wellbeing
* Practical experience of supporting management of Health and Safety risks and / or processes in a high-risk environment
The role holder is required to gain one or more of the following QCF / NQF level 3 qualifications
* NEBOSH General Certificate in Occupational Health and Safety
* Level 3 NVQ in Occupational Safety and Health Practice
* NEBOSH or IEMA Certificate in Environment Management
* Equivalent qualifications in Safety, Health and / or Environment subject
Desirable:
* NEBOSH General Certificate or equivalent
* Audit and investigation skills

The SHE Team:
This position is designed to support the development of individuals entering the Safety, Health & Environmental (SHE) profession, particularly those with transferrable skills seeking to progress into SHE Advisor roles. As a SHE Associate, you will play a vital role in promoting and maintain a safe and healthy working environment, contributing to on the UK’s most advanced engineering programmes – the construction and delivery of Nuclear Submarines. You’ll gain valuable experience while providing professional SHE advice in a highly regulated and technical complex setting. Please be aware that many roles at BAE Systems are subject to both security and export control restrictions. These restrictions mean that factors such as your nationality, any nationalities you may have previously held, and your place of birth can restrict the roles you are eligible to perform within the organisation. All applicants must as a minimum achieve Baseline Personnel Security Standard. Many roles also require higher levels of National Security Vetting where applicants must typically leave 5 to 10 years of continuous residency in the UK depending in the vetting level required for the role, to allow for meaningful security vetting checks.
